Output 1cf604047ee17c4a59ee3fed08d4d375dbe6c1b65652b4ed18fd28a77fcc54df:27

value
634937
script pubkey
OP_0 OP_PUSHBYTES_20 c03921ed5c54cb2ce7a4179348611f11103351bd
address
bc1qcqujrm2u2n9jeeayz7f5scglzygrx5da4hgrah
transaction
1cf604047ee17c4a59ee3fed08d4d375dbe6c1b65652b4ed18fd28a77fcc54df
confirmations
139386
spent
true